Construction worker stole cell phone: NY Post

OZONE PARK — A construction worker was arrested after allegedly swiping a teenager's cell phone on Lefferts Boulevard Sept. 17, the New York Post reported.

Police said Kapiledo Etwaroo, 20, allegedly stopped the 15-year-old victim and his younger brother near the corner of 109th Avenue and asked to use his phone, the Post reported.

When the teen obliged, Etwaroo allegedly walked away with the phone in hand after telling the victim that he would have to fight him to get it back, the Post reported.

The teen called police and Etwaroo was arrested by police on petit larceny and harassment charges a short time later, police said.
